As one of those aforementioned couch spuds (and a sneaker fan), I have noted with interest that the humble sneaker has left vital clues in many an episode of CSI. but HOW to separate fact from fiction? What role does the sneaker play in the forensic sciences? Aficionados may understandably muse over the merits of the speckled or gum sole, but the folks in the crime lab are more interested in the print shoes leave behind. As it happens, shoe prints are incredibly important clues often left at crime scenes.

The number of shoe print patterns out there is huge. Shoe print indices and databases have been developed in various countries. Commercial company Foster and Freeman have a range of software tools to identify shoes, including SICAR and SoleMate. Forensic Science Services (FSS) is a UK Government owned company that released an online footwear coding and detection management system this year, entitled Footwear Intelligence Technology.

I contacted Laura Mackin at the FSS who informed me that they have records of more than 20,000 shoe prints of which approximately 90 per cent come from sneakers. I was intrigued as to how the database was compiled; were they getting shoes from the manufacturers? From shops? As it happens, all of the prints come from shoes given to the FSS by the 43 police forces around the UK, either from marks left at a crime scene or from sneakers confiscated from a suspect. Interestingly, the FSS don’t have any special agreements with manufacturers. This was a bit of a disappointment as I was hoping to learn that the most comprehensive sneaker collection in the UK was at the FSS.

The FSS also offer the fantastically named ‘Cinderella Service’, which helps identify personal information about suspects including the angle of their footfall and weight distribution. Facey wrote in the journal Pattern Recognition that ‘shape and extent of the the general wear apparent on a shoe sole contains information about the foot function and gait of the wearer.’ The use of US Army anthropometric databases has allowed models to predict height based on shoe size. English tabloid newspaper The Mirror reported this June, with perhaps a hint of schadenfreude at the shoe manufacturer’s expense, that sneakers are the most popular shoes used by criminals as evidenced by shoe prints, and listed the top ten shoes for English crims.

The list I received from the FSS was exactly the same; so there haven’t been any changes in the sneaker buying habits of the criminal world in the last few months. Whilst this list may provoke some tittering amongst tabloid readers or annoyance for the manufacturers PR companies, no mention is made of what the top ten sneakers sold are, and whether the two lists are significantly different; ie most bad boys may wear the top ten listed but perhaps so do the general population in England. It would be interesting to see how these lists vary between countries. The data is also for all crimes, rather than category of crime. The FSS doesn’t store this info, and I can imagine the manufacturers are at least grateful for that.

As with any forensic test, the shoe print is not a tool to be used without caution. A survey in the 1996 issue of Forensic Science International demonstrated ‘remarkable variations’ in conclusions of shoe print reports from different laboratories examining the same cases! Hopefully computer databases have reduced the error rate. Miss Mackin (FSS) informed me that ‘footwear is the second most common evidence type after DNA and is capable of definitively putting someone at a crime scene, particularly thanks to the unique wear marks that each pair will have’.

Sometimes the teacher learns more from the student than the student does from the teacher. Hopefully, not too often, but today I would like to share with you some great practicing ideas that have come from my piano students over the years:

1. A Colonel in Virginia that I taught for several years got up at 4AM every weekday morning and practiced on an electronic keyboard with headphones so he wouldn't disturb anyone at that time of the morning. "I love the early morning", he said, "because it's so quiet and peaceful and I'm fresh and raring to go. No phones are ringing, no people walking into the room, no disturbances at all. I practice for a half-hour, have breakfast, and then hit it for another half-hour -- all before I have to show up for work. When I get home in the evening, if I'm too tired to practice, I don't feel guilty because I've already got my licks in for the day. And if I'm up to practicing some more -- well, it's a bonus!"

2. An elementary school teacher in Indiana told me she took each piece I assigned her and transposed it into all 12 keys -- not written out, but at the piano -- in her head. She said "It doesn't always sound so hot, but I find that if I keep at it day after day, I can at least get by in the most difficult keys, and it makes the easier keys seem real simple. And it gives me a perspective that I just wouldn't get it I just played it in one key -- the key it is written in. I've learned that each key has it's own "feel", and some keys are bright (like "D") and some keys are mellow (like "Db").

3. Another piano student with a similar idea, who was the Minister of Music in a Catholic church, said he took one whole month of the year and devoted it to mastering just one key. Since there are 12 months in the year and 12 Major keys, that works out perfectly. So in January he played everything he could find in the key of C, and transposed anything that wasn't in C into C. In February he went up 1/2 step to the key of C# (also known as Db enharmonically) and played everything in Db and searched for pieces written in the key of Db, and so on. By the time the year was up, he had a pretty fair grasp on the 12 Major keys. I suggested that he devote the next year to the 12 minor keys, and the next year to the modes, and the next year to polytonality, etc., etc. -- but as I recall he decided to just recycle through the 12 major keys, since he used them so much more than the ones I suggested.

4. Still another piano student took an idea from me and twisted it a bit. I suggested that she play along with pieces she liked on tapes and CD's, so she would get a feel for the motion of the song. (I used to do that by the hour when I was a teen-ager, and it paid off big time for me!). She took the idea and tried it and liked it so much that she started getting videos of people playing the piano. She arranged her TV and video player so that she could be at her piano while the video was playing, and she would play along with the pianist on the screen, following her/his hand motions and arm motions and finger position and thereby getting a feeling for the flow of the music. (Patterning). Her creativity is paying off for her -- she is advancing rapidly. (And by the way, don't think she is "copying" the person she is watching -- not at all. It's the same principle as watching Michael Jordan moving toward the basket, or watching Sammy Sosa swing a bat -- it just gets you in the right groove before you apply your own style to it.)

5. A doctor I have taught for years makes a idea file of things he has learned about piano playing over the years. He notes where in a given book or tape or video I discuss such and such a topic, and files that alphabetically. Then later when he needs to refer to that idea, he simply looks up the idea in his file, locates the video or cassette or book, and presto -- he can review that idea or concept almost instantly. It's like a card catalog in the library -- makes finding things so much faster than flipping through endless books trying to find that idea you saw long ago.
With the advent of the computer a person could store and categorize ideas such as this very quickly.
